The ACC starts to brake heavily whenever there is even a slight bend on the motorway which is really annoying!

Is there anyway to fix a speed and keep at that speed?

I understand if there’s a car up front and it slows down because of this but even the smallest of bends leads to the car braking.
 
The latest available update that changed increments from 5mph/kph to 1mph/kph also addressed the "slowing down in bends" issue ... you now need to have a much more pronounced steering angle for the car to start slowing down. I (mostly) like the way ACC works now. :)
